This area is usually what most of the exciting Investment Banking movies revolve around and it\u2019s here that the real game is played. The \u2018front office\u2019 is divided into Sales and Trading, Corporate Finance and Research. It may be seen that the recent times have been experiencing a great amount of technological change in these three sub-fields of Investment Banking. Artificial Intelligence and business process automation are two of the many analytics technologies, with the help of which these three fields are attempted to be deconstructed.<br \/>\nLet\u2019s begin with Sales and Trading, roles in this sphere are popularly known as the alpha roles in Investment Banking. The professionals working on these positions were considered to be the leaders of the wolf pack and they were very capable of getting away with just about anything. This has changed as the \u2018nerds\u2019 have steadily begun to replace them. This shift is the result of technology specifically, computer engineers taking up the positions. Goldman Sachs reportedly had over 30% of computer engineers as their traders. Recently another big gun, JP Morgan hired their Global Head of Machine Learning from Microsoft. What is surprising about this recruitment, is that the professional has absolutely no background in finance whatsoever.<br \/>\nWhen it comes to Investment Banks, a huge chunk of their work is carried on by the Mergers and Acquisitions Departments and the IPOs. The field of IPOs is also being transformed, much similarly to what the CFO of Goldman Sachs has to say. He says, \u201cGoldman Sachs has already mapped 146 distinct steps taken in IPOs offering stock and most of them are begging to be automated\u201d. It won\u2019t be long before stock market is made up of all the secondary markets created by FinTech companies.<br \/>\nAnyone who is a finance aspirant\u00a0would be expected to know the difference between \u2018active funds\u2019 and \u2018passive funds\u2019. The million dollar ideas of all of those Portfolio Managers who build active products come from paid research teams at various Investment Banks. In the recent times, this basic financial commentary is speedily automated.
